Safety Data Sheet for Poly Aluminum Chloride and Its Applications and Handling Guidelines



Understanding Poly Aluminum Chloride Safety Data and Applications


Poly Aluminum Chloride (PAC) is a versatile and widely used chemical compound found in various industrial applications, particularly in water treatment processes. As with any chemical, understanding its safety data is crucial for handling and usage to ensure the well-being of individuals and the environment.


Composition and Properties


Poly Aluminum Chloride is an aluminum-based coagulant that comes in various formulations. Its chemical structure consists of aluminum, chlorine, and hydroxide ions, providing it with properties that promote coagulation and flocculation. The compound typically appears as a white or yellowish powder and is soluble in water, forming a clear solution. This solubility allows PAC to interact effectively with suspended particles in water, facilitating their removal during treatment processes.


Applications


One of the primary applications of PAC is in the treatment of drinking water and wastewater. It helps to remove impurities, including heavy metals, organic matter, and microorganisms, by promoting the aggregation of suspended solids into larger flocs that can be easily settled or filtered out. Additionally, PAC is used in the treatment of industrial effluents, paper manufacturing, and even in the cosmetics industry.


In the food industry, PAC is sometimes utilized as a processing aid in compliance with health regulations. Its efficiency in reducing turbidity and improving water quality has made it a popular choice among municipalities for enhancing the treatment of drinking water.


Safety Data Sheets (SDS)


Safety Data Sheets (SDS) are crucial documents that provide detailed information about the hazards, handling, storage, and emergency measures related to chemicals, including PAC. The SDS for Poly Aluminum Chloride contains several important sections

1. Identification This section includes the chemical name, synonyms, and use of the substance. It helps users understand what PAC is and its applications.


2. Hazard Identification Although PAC is generally considered safe when used correctly, the SDS outlines potential health risks. It may cause respiratory irritation or skin and eye irritation upon contact. Therefore, it’s important for users to be cautious during handling to minimize exposure.


3. Composition/Information on Ingredients This details the formulation of PAC, including its concentration and any hazardous components, allowing users to make informed decisions regarding safety and handling procedures.


4. First-Aid Measures In case of exposure, the SDS provides guidance on immediate actions to be taken, such as rinsing the affected area with water and seeking medical assistance if necessary.


5. Handling and Storage Safe handling practices are essential when working with PAC. The SDS recommends storing the chemical in a cool, dry place away from incompatible substances and proper personal protective equipment (PPE) should always be used, including gloves and safety goggles.


6. Environmental Protection PAC is biodegradable; however, the SDS emphasizes the importance of avoiding discharge into natural water bodies without proper treatment, as it can still affect aquatic ecosystems.


Conclusion


Poly Aluminum Chloride plays a critical role in various industries, particularly in water treatment processes. While it is an effective coagulant with numerous applications, understanding its safety data is essential for responsible handling and usage. By adhering to the guidelines provided in the Safety Data Sheet, operators can minimize risks, ensuring both personal safety and environmental protection. As industries continue to seek efficient solutions for water purification and waste management, PAC will likely remain a key player in achieving these goals while ensuring safety and compliance with regulations.
